How cosmonauts fulfill children's dreams: meeting with a Hero of Russia will take place at the Exposition April 13
It is no
secret that the space of the International RUSSIA EXPO is a place to meet
incredible people from the world of culture and business, politics and other
spheres. Among other things, every Saturday at the Roscosmos exposition the
already traditional meetings with cosmonauts are held. This time it will be
possible to talk to Sergei Kud-Sverchkov, Hero of Russia, cosmonaut of
Roscosmos, ambassador of the Unity Foundation.
Unity
Foundation helps people with cancer to enjoy life, realize themselves and
fulfill their dreams. Cosmonauts also support the good deeds of the foundation.
At the meeting Sergei Kud-Sverchkov will tell what and to whom cosmonauts
write, how messages get from Earth to the ISS, and how space fulfills the
dreams of children with cancer.
At the meeting it will be possible to ask questions to the cosmonaut and to get charged with the energy of space from the unique spacesuit "Victory" with children's dreams, which recently returned from the ISS. Sergei will present memorable space gifts for the best, most interesting and unusual questions.
It should be noted that Kud-Sverchkov first went into space in 2020 on the Soyuz MS-17 spacecraft together with Roscosmos cosmonaut Sergei Ryzhikov and NASA astronaut Kathleen Rubins. During that flight, an "ultra-fast" two-turn approach scheme was used for the first time, which allowed the spacecraft to reach the ISS and dock with the Rassvet module in just 3 hours and 3 minutes.
